Parking Lot Expansion in Orange County, CA
Parking lot expansion services involve enlarging existing paved areas to accommodate more vehicles or improve traffic flow on residential or commercial properties. These projects typically include adding new asphalt or concrete surfaces, extending current parking configurations, or creating additional access points. Homeowners and property owners often seek this service when they need more parking space for guests, tenants, or customers, or when existing lots become crowded or outdated. Before requesting parking lot expansion, it’s helpful to consider factors such as the current lot size, the desired increase in capacity, local zoning regulations, and any necessary permits or approvals.
Understanding the scope of the project is essential for property owners considering parking lot expansion. They should evaluate the property’s layout, drainage requirements, and potential impact on landscaping or existing structures. Clarifying the intended use, the number of additional parking spaces needed, and any specific design preferences can help ensure the project aligns with long-term needs. Consulting with professionals can provide guidance on site preparation, materials, and compliance requirements to support a smooth and effective expansion process.

Common Parking Lot Expansion Jobs
Parking Lot Expansion - enlarges existing parking areas to accommodate more vehicles.
Paving and Surfacing - installs durable asphalt or concrete surfaces for expanded lots.
Driveway Extensions - extends current driveways to increase parking capacity.
Lot Resurfacing - repairs and smooths existing surfaces for improved safety and appearance.
Layout Reconfiguration - redesigns lot layouts to optimize parking space usage.
Drainage Solutions - incorporates drainage systems to prevent water pooling after expansion.
Parking Lot Expansion Questions
What types of parking lot expansion projects are common? Projects often include adding new parking spaces, enlarging existing lots, or reconfiguring layouts to improve traffic flow.
What should property owners consider before expanding a parking lot? It is important to evaluate available space, drainage needs, and any local zoning or permitting requirements.
How does parking lot expansion impact property value? Expanding parking can increase accessibility and convenience, potentially enhancing property value and appeal.
What materials are typically used for parking lot expansion? Common materials include asphalt and concrete, chosen based on durability and project requirements.
